### Key Ceremony Checklist — Item 7: Session-Token Refresh Hotfix

Before signing the hotfix build for the session-token refresh bug (tokens expiring mid-refresh, forcing re-login), confirm: two ceremony witnesses present, hardware token for the Larkspur signing module inserted, and the previous signing log reconciled. Release manager verifies the hotfix tag matches the approved change record. Once witnesses confirm, unseal the ceremony envelope and enter the recovery passphrase that appears immediately below.

vault phrase of tajeg-tageg = pelix-druix-holius-briael-zorwyn-frawyn-fraox-norok-drueth-aldiel

**Break-glass: Report export timezones (Larkfield Analytics)**

Exports default to UTC. Tenant-local offsets come from the Merridew config service — never hardcode them. If Merridew is down and a client export is blocking, use break-glass access to the override table. The break-glass console requires the standing recovery passphrase, which follows below.

vault phrase of yahap-kajof = fraath-ralael

Heads up: we vendor all third-party fonts for Quillmark ourselves instead of pulling them from the foundry CDN at runtime. The sync job mirrors the Glyphbarn catalog into our asset bucket every Sunday night, so if fonts look stale mid-week, that's usually a failed sync, not a cache issue. Rerun it with scripts/font-sync.sh and check the logs. The sync job needs the foundry access credential, which lives on the very next line of this file.

vault entry, yahif-yajep: COURIER_KEY29=b802bdf8034096b65a51c6ba5abe2